1. The "Zero-Layer" Philosophy

The strongest selling point of this template is Reinholdt’s famous dismissal of the traditional AutoCAD layering standard. Downloading a file claiming to be the “30x40

  • Standard AutoCAD: Relies on complex layer hierarchies (A-WALL, A-FLOR, etc.) that require constant toggling.
  • 30x40 Approach: Uses a "Everything on Layer 0" philosophy. Instead of managing layers, the template relies on ByLayer properties and specific CTB (Plot Style) files.
  • Benefit: This drastically reduces the cognitive load. You draw, you assign a line weight via the properties bar, and you move on. It eliminates the headache of hunting for the "correct" layer every time you want to draw a toilet or a wall.
